To me unenlightened person, this seems to point at some parsing problem: [14:35:13] Checking version of Apache [ OK ] [14:35:14] Info: Found application 'httpd' version '1.3.29': this version is whitelisted. [14:35:14] Checking version of Bind DNS [ Warning ] [14:35:14] Warning: Application 'named', version '9.4.2-P2', is out of date, and possibly a security risk. [14:35:14] Checking version of OpenSSL [ OK ]
#APP_WHITELIST="" APP_WHITELIST="httpd:1.3.29 named:9.4.2-P2 openssl:0.9.8k php:5.2.10" # named -v BIND 9.4.2-P2 I guess the '-' makes all the difference?
